Quality | Standard | Material No. | Old designation |
---|---|---|---|
S500MC | DIN EN 10149-2 | 1.0984 | QStE500TM |
Testing direction | Yield strength Rp0.2 (MPa) min. | Tensile strength Rm (MPa) | Elongation A80 (in %) min < 3 mm | Elongation A80 (in %) min > 3 mm |
---|---|---|---|---|
L | 500 | 550-700 | 12 | 14 |
C % | Si % | Mn % | P % | S % | Al % | Nb % | Ti % | V % |
---|---|---|---|---|---|---|---|---|
≤ 0,12 | ≤0,50 | ≤ 1,70 | ≤ 0,025 | ≤ 0,015 | ≥ 0,015 | ≤ 0,09 | ≤ 0,15 | ≤ 0,20 |

The role of microalloying
Microalloying plays an important role in the refinement of S500MC. By adding small amounts of certain elements such as vanadium, niobium and titanium, the strength and toughness of the steel is increased without compromising its weldability.
